2 Kings 1:9–12
Elijah Calls Fire from Heaven on Two Platoons of Soldiers
King Ahaziah sends a captain with fifty soldiers to summon Elijah. The captain orders the prophet down: 'Man of God, the king says come down.' Elijah's answer is terse — 'If I am a man of God, let fire come down from heaven and consume you and your fifty.' Fire falls. All fifty-one die. The king sends another captain with fifty more soldiers, who delivers the same command with the same threat. Fire falls again. A third captain is sent. He falls on his knees and begs for his life. This time an angel tells Elijah: go with him.
